The Cranbrook Public Library opened its door on July 4, 1925, meaning we are turning 100! It is not so much a celebration of us, but a celebration of you—and everyone who has used the library during the past century. Congratulations to all of us!
The next book sale for the Friends of the Cranbrook Public Library is fast approaching. It will be in the Manual Training School adjacent to the Library. Friday, June 6 is for Friends Members only from 3pm to 5 pm. Sat. June 7th everyone is welcome from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m.
There are loads of books for all ages, puzzles, magazines, DVDs and Audiobooks. Cash or cheque only. This is the last sale until the fall so come in and find your summer reading!
Donations for this sale can be dropped off at the Welcome Desk in the Library anytime. Items in good condition are appreciated and magazines must be published within the last two years.
All proceeds support programs and services at the Cranbrook Public Library.
